Crypto Hacks Double to $1.6 Billion as Prices Jump, Report Shows

The value of crypto hacks almost doubled to $1.6 billion in the first seven months of 2024, inflated by a jump in digital-asset prices, according to Chainalysis Inc.

Tokyo’s share market closes Thursday’s session with gains over US rate cut outlook

Tokyo's Stock market closed higher on Thursday, buoyed by gains on Wall Street and bolstered by encouraging economic data from Japan. The positive sentiment was fueled by hopes that the U.S. Federal Reserve might cut interest rates following recent economic indicators and Japan’s better-than-expected GDP figures. SIA, Scoot flights between Singapore and Tokyo affected as Typhoon Ampil nears Japan

SINGAPORE – Several flights between Singapore and Tokyo on Aug 16 have been affected as Typhoon Ampil moves towards Japan. Two Scoot flights, TR874 and TR875, on Aug 16 have been cancelled, Scoot told The Straits Times on Aug 15. ( read original story ...)
